In the contemporary digital era, cloud computing has become essential for businesses and organizations worldwide. The ability to remotely store, manage, and access data and apps has drastically changed how we work and interact. 

However, it’s important to recognize the distinctions and overlaps between these two industries’ titans when deciding which cloud provider is best for your company.

In this post, we will examine the essential features, price structures, scalability, dependability, and overall performance of Google Cloud and AWS in detail. 

So let’s investigate the worlds of Google Cloud and AWS and their distinctive offers to see how they differ in the fiercely competitive cloud computing market.

What is AWS?

Amazon’s cloud computing platform, AWS (Amazon Web Services), is expanding extensively. It combines infrastructure-as-a-service (IaaS), platform-as-a-service (PaaS), and packaged software-as-a-service (SaaS) products. 

AWS is divided into various services, each of which can be customized based on the user’s requirements. Users can view individual server maps and configuration parameters for an AWS service.

Why AWS?

The following are some significant advantages of using AWS web services:

  • Amazon Web Services (AWS) provides a simple approach to deploying an app.
  • With no upfront costs or long-term obligations, it is a cost-effective service that enables you to pay only for the services you need.
  • When you have DevOps teams that can manage and set up the infrastructure, you should use AWS.
  • You don’t have much time to devote to releasing a new edition of your online or mobile application.
  • AWS web service is the best choice if your project requires a lot of processing power.
  • A variety of automated features, including setup, scalability, and configuration.
  • You have instant, unrestricted access to the cloud.
  • Thanks to AWS, organizations can use well-known programming languages, operating systems, databases, and architectural frameworks.

The Drawbacks of AWS

The following are the disadvantages/cons of using AWS Cloud:

  • The lengthy and difficult AWS deployment process can take up to 15 to 20 minutes for a simple website.
  • Faulty deployment with no error message
  • For startups without a strong technical background, AWS is not the best choice.
  • In AWS, launching several app instances is an extremely challenging task.

What is Google Cloud?

In 2011, Google introduced the Google Cloud Platform (GCP). This cloud computing infrastructure supports a company’s expansion and success. It also enables you to benefit from Google’s infrastructure and offers extremely flexible, intelligent, and secure services to them.

Why Google Cloud?

The following are some advantages of using Google Cloud services:

  • Infrastructure fit for the future.
  • Increases productivity by giving quick access to innovations.
  • Offers setup of instances and payments.
  • Workers can operate remotely from wherever.
  • Offers strong data analytics cost-effectiveness brought on by long-term savings.
  • Products for big data and machine learning.
  • With a strong emphasis on the microservices architecture, it offers a serverless environment that enables you to link cloud services.

Drawbacks of Google Cloud

The cons of using Google Cloud are as follows:

  • Little parts challenging to start
  • Everything that is not free tier is a cost.
  • Has fewer features than AWS.

Key Distinctions between Google Cloud Platform and Amazon Web Services

AWS is a secure cloud service created and maintained by Amazon, whereas Google Cloud is a collection of Google’s public cloud computing resources & services.

  • While AWS provides Amazon Simple Storage Services, Google Cloud provides Google Cloud Storage.
  • In contrast to AWS, which transmits data in a broad format, Google Cloud services transmit data in a fully encrypted format.
  • AWS volume is 500 GB to 16 TB, while Google Cloud ranges from 1 GB to 64 TB.
  • Although AWS offers cloud-based disaster recovery services, Google Cloud offers backup services.

A Comprehensive Difference: Google Cloud vs AWS

Aspect AWS Google Cloud Platform (GCP)
Market Dominance Market leader with a significant customer base Strong competitor rapidly gaining market share
Services Offered A broad range of services covering diverse needs A comprehensive suite of services with specialization
Compute Options EC2, Lambda, and more Compute Engine, App Engine, Cloud Functions
Storage Options S3, EBS, Glacier, and more Cloud Storage, Cloud SQL, Bigtable, Cloud Spanner
Pricing Models Pay-as-you-go, various pricing options are available Pay-as-you-go, sustained usage discounts, custom
Scalability Excellent scalability with auto-scaling features Elastic scaling and auto-scaling capabilities
Global Infrastructure Extensive global data center presence Expanding the network of data centers worldwide
Machine Learning (ML) Amazon SageMaker, Rekognition, and more Cloud AutoML, TensorFlow, AI Platform
Analytics and Big Data Amazon Redshift, EMR, Athena, and more BigQuery, Dataflow, Dataproc, Pub/Sub
Networking VPC, ELB, Route 53, and more Virtual Private Cloud (VPC), Load Balancing, DNS
Developer Friendliness Robust SDKs, CLI, and extensive documentation Easy-to-use interfaces and comprehensive docs
Reliability and Uptime Strong reputation for reliability and uptime SLA guarantees highly reliable infrastructure

Which Should You Choose? 

Organizations looking for a full suite of cloud solutions frequently prefer AWS due to its wide selection of services and established market dominance. 

With a developed ecosystem and a wide range of computing and storage options, it can accommodate businesses with various needs. Additionally, AWS’s significant emphasis on big data, analytics, and machine learning capabilities gives businesses an advantage in these fields. 

On the other hand, GCP presents itself as a strong competitor, rapidly gaining popularity with its comprehensive suite of services and a strong focus on data analytics and machine learning. 

GCP’s developer-friendly interfaces, competitive pricing models, and seamless integration with other Google services make it an attractive choice for startups, smaller businesses, and organizations leveraging Google’s ecosystem.


So, both AWS and Google Cloud are reliable platforms. Therefore, before choosing, you should know what kind of feature your company requires and how much you are willing to spend. 

